       A Game to Remember.

From the opening whistle, the Lions set the tone for the game with explosive energy and a fierce determination that

left the Seahawks scrambling. Quarterback Jared Goff was on fire, executing plays with precision and confidence that

had the Seattle defense on its heels. Goff connected seamlessly with his receiving corps, especially with star wideout

Amon-Ra St. Brown, who delivered a standout performance, racking up crucial yards and scoring a touchdown.

The Lions’ offense was relentless, combining an effective passing game with a powerful rushing attack led by running

back David Montgomery. Montgomery, who has quickly become a fan favorite, found holes in the Seahawks’ defense,

consistently gaining yards and keeping the chains moving. His ability to break tackles and gain extra yards was

pivotal in maintaining drives and wearing down the opposition.

       Defensive Domination.

While the offense shone brightly, it was the Lions’ defense that truly put the game out of reach. The defensive line,

bolstered by standout performances from Aidan Hutchinson and Alim McNeill, put constant pressure on Seahawks

quarterback Geno Smith. Smith struggled to find his rhythm, facing a barrage of sacks and hurries that disrupted

Seattle’s game plan.

The Lions’ secondary also made significant contributions, with cornerback Jeff Okudah snagging an interception

that turned the tide in the Lions’ favor. This critical play showcased the Lions’ ability to capitalize on mistakes, a

hallmark of championship teams. The defense not only stifled the Seahawks’ running game but also limited their

explosive passing options, effectively neutralizing Seattle’s offensive threats.
